- adjective isometrics of, relating to, or having equality of measure. 1
- adjective isometrics of or relating to isometric exercise. 1
- adjective isometrics Crystallography. noting or pertaining to that system of crystallization that is characterized by three equal axes at right angles to one another. Compare crystal system. 1
- adjective isometrics Prosody. of equal measure; made up of regular feet. 1
- adjective isometrics Drafting. designating a method of projection (isometric projection) in which a three-dimensional object is represented by a drawing (i·somet·ric draw·ing) having the horizontal edges of the object drawn usually at a 30° angle and all verticals projected perpendicularly from a horizontal base, all lines being drawn to scale. Compare orthographic projection. 1
